Need New Intake Manifold

Ok, So I built a 388c.i.d SBC. I put on new Edlebrock Victor Jr. 210cc intake heads. The heads were port matched to a felpro 1206 gasket. The intake ports are VERY large.
I went to install 2 manifolds I had laying around and neither of them fit. The only one that came close was the Performer RPM. So I installed that with a 1205 gasket but this auctually created a vacuum leak. So I put some silicone around the where it was leaking and broke the engine in.
Well now It is time for me to decide on a new intake manifold. My camshaft is a Comp Cams NX284 Nitrous cam. .507/.525 lift. I am using a 750CFM Speed Demon Carb. The valves on the heads are 2.08/1.6 these heads are very high flowing heads. I was told that they might even be too big for my lil 388... So I dont want to spend $500+ on a Super Victor CNC intake but I need something that will work. Any suggestions? I want to make power between 2500-6500RPM. Remember that the gasket is a felpro 1206 (its auctually very close to a felpro 1207 but I will settle for a 1206 port size.)

I have a Weiand Single plane manifold it is wayy too small, it is made for the felpro 1205. The Victor Jr single plane is also too small. I went to a local speed shop and checked some intakes out. Even they are not sure what to do.

My intake ports are matched to a 1206 or 1207 and the 1207 measures 1.38"x2.28" and the 1206 measures 1.34"x2.21" whereas the 1205 measures 1.28"x2.09"

That is a .2" difference in height and it is noticable. Many intakes just dont sit on my heads without the ports showing.

The Vic Jr. intake will work fine. You can buy a version of the Vic Jr. that is already CNC port matched to a #1206 gasket opening (Edelbrock part number #2900). That means..... you can also take a run-of-the-mill non-port-matched Vic Jr. from a swap meet (the very common #2975) and hog it out yourself to a 1206 gasket size with no problem.

There's no real problem if the manifold opening is slightly smaller than the port opening on the head. Other way around is not advised, however.

Oops.... my bad. I went and read further. The CNC Vic Jr. is ported out to a 1205 gasket opening but they recommend using a 1206 gasket (I guess so the gasket doesn't have any chance of overhanging the intake manifold opening).

The Weiand Team G intakes are slightly bigger than that at 2.10x1.24 out of the box. You can take them further but I doubt you'll get up in the 2.30" height dimension with them before you encounter some sort of trouble/compromises.

Looks like a Super Vic for you!
